International Baltic Road Conference 2025

The Baltic Road Association (BRA) was established in 2014 in Estonia as a non-profit organization. It continues the collaboration between the road administrations of Estonia, Latvia, and Lithuania, which began in 1989. Additionally, it serves as a continuation of the cooperation initiated in 1932.

The main goal of the Baltic Road Association (BRA) is to foster opportunities for mutual collaboration, such as:

Conducting joint research;

Coordinating the activities of technical expert groups;

Organizing seminars on topics of shared interest;

Hosting the International Baltic Road Conference every four years;

Participating in the alignment process of EU road sector legislation, when necessary;

Collaborating with other related international organizations.

The presidency of the BRA rotates every four years. From 2021 to 2025, Lithuania holds the presidency. This period will culminate in an international conference and exhibition, summarizing Lithuania’s leadership activities during its term.
